I bought this pen to replace my favorite pen, a Waterman Charleston, that I accidentally left at an airport security checkpoint. The Phineas was half the price of my Charleston (in case I have another senior moment), and performs well for the money. The steel nib flows well, although I much preferred the smoother flow of the Charleston's gold nib. Rating: 3 out of 5 stars - Looks nice, quality is nothing special
I have a Sheaffer which I got for half the price, and that actually works a little better. This Waterman doesn't quite flow as well.

Waterman added a metal tube to the inside, but it's just a tube they dropped in (and maybe glued?); the metal tube is not part of the pen's general structure. Most of it is plastic, including all screw threads.
